SoFi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:SOFI) Receives $12.50 Consensus Target Price from Analysts

Shares of SoFi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:SOFIGet Free Report) have earned an average recommendation of “Hold” from the sixteen brokerages that are presently covering the stock, MarketBeat reports. Four equities research anal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ating, six have issued a hold rating, five have given a buy rating and one has given a strong buy rating to the company. The average 12 month target price among brokerages that have issued a report on the stock in the last year is $12.50.

A number of analysts recently commented on SOFI shares. The Goldman Sachs Group lifted their price objective on SoFi Technologies from $8.50 to $9.50 and gave the stock a “neutral” rating in a research report on Tuesday, January 28th. UBS Group boosted their price objective on shares of SoFi Technologies from $10.50 to $14.00 and gave the company a “neutral” rating in a research report on Tuesday, January 28th. William Blair restated an “outperform” rating on shares of SoFi Technologies in a research report on Friday, January 24th. JPMorgan Chase & Co. boosted their price target on SoFi Technologies from $9.00 to $16.00 and gave the company a “neutral” rating in a report on Monday, December 2nd. Finally, Dbs Bank raised SoFi Technologies to a “strong-buy” rating in a research note on Friday, February 21st.

SoFi Technologies Stock Performance

Shares of SOFI opened at $12.87 on Thursday. The company has a 50-day moving average of $14.67 and a two-hundred day moving average of $13.01. The stock has a market cap of $14.11 billion, a P/E ratio of 34.78, a PEG ratio of 2.24 and a beta of 1.79. SoFi Technologies has a 12-month low of $6.01 and a 12-month high of $18.42. The company has a current ratio of 0.49, a quick ratio of 0.18 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.52.

SoFi Technologies (NASDAQ:SOFIG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Monday, January 27th. The company reported $0.05 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.04 by $0.01. SoFi Technologies had a return on equity of 3.82% and a net margin of 18.64%.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company posted $0.04 earnings per share. As a group, research analysts predict that SoFi Technologies will post 0.26 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About SoFi Technologies

SoFi Technologies, Inc provides various financial services in the United States, Latin America, and Canada. It operates through three segments: Lending, Technology Platform, and Financial Services. The company offers lending and financial services and products that allows its members to borrow, save, spend, invest, and protect money.
